Samsung engineers LCD screen from ordinary glass!
Er. | Nov 1 2007

This Wednesday, South Korean Samsung Electronics Co. has publicized something that their rivals were afraid of already! The company researcher boasted of designing a liquid crystal display (LCD) screen incorporating an ordinary glass plate; does that mean we are looking forward to a much cheaper LCD-world ahead?

This Soda-Lime thin film transistor, TFT, LCD screen can bestow you with SXGA-level resolution, 1000:1 contrast ratio, and off-course giving you all those contemporary LCD feature options too!

At present, the ordinary glass is not used because of some industry limitations and shortcomings (ordinary glass melts at temperatures higher than 300 Celsius degrees causing undesirable chemical reactions) regarding the same, but Samsung clarified that this hottest LCD is based on the normal glass plate.

Samsung would now develop LCDs at temperatures lower than 300 Celsius degrees, thus giving shape to a completely new world of LCD-enhancement possibilities!
